Transaction 766728a6bcf3a56b071aa728c8c6992780fc95e51e6d2031ad286d19b56e1e87
1 Input
1 Output
-
766728a6bcf3a56b071aa728c8c6992780fc95e51e6d2031ad286d19b56e1e87:0
- value
- 2606629
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 de2d05b5d403fe498b1cf82a31962522b403275c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MFkwnsursPfETcZqAoY2H2C3WdmMSniGz